Transaction 31e53df90ce8b470a247d9e341f7fd4f3cb3a4ce55f9a8e5218b8629048fc79a

1 Input
2 Outputs
  • 31e53df90ce8b470a247d9e341f7fd4f3cb3a4ce55f9a8e5218b8629048fc79a:0
  • value  21180
    address  3HqXbRPMdeMx2RtSU56HzST3eCJzvcKxVX
  • 31e53df90ce8b470a247d9e341f7fd4f3cb3a4ce55f9a8e5218b8629048fc79a:1
  • value  108972282
    address  3AgTAm6JNAPnhumMigfmQMkWaWna8u4wCx